 About us 
 
Founded by famous serial entrepreneurs in 2011 and a member of the first batch of graduates from the Belgian startup studio eFounders, TextMaster is the first global solution for professional translation that is available entirely online. 
Thanks to a network of expert translators, cutting-edge technologies, and a range of value-added services, TextMaster enables companies to streamline the translation of their content in over 150 language combinations and 100 areas of expertise. TextMaster is available as SaaS, as an API or through one of the technological integrations created by one of its partners. 
More than 10,000 companies of all sizes and from all industries turn to TextMaster for assistance with their international expansion, including world leaders such as LVMH, Boden, Veepee, Westwing or Club Med. 
TextMaster was acquired by the Acolad group, the European leader of professional translation, in March 2018. This allows TextMaster to accelerate its development all over Europe, to meet increasingly complex challenges regarding translation projects, and to address larger customers.

OurTechnical environment 
 
·         Back-end: Ruby on Rails (Rails 4.x, 5.x), JRuby, Elixir, GraphQL, RabbitMQ, CQRS 
·         Front-end: React, Redux, Redux-Saga, NodeJS, Webpack, ES9 / Babel, Flexbox, GraphQL, Apollo 
·         Database: MongoDB, Elasticsearch, Redis, Postgres, Neo4j 
·         Infrastructure: GCP, AWS, Azure, Kubernetes, Istio, Docker, Terraform, Cloudflare 
·         Testing: RSpec, Capybara, Selenium 
·         Source control: Github 
·         Continuous Integration: SemaphoreCI 
·         Monitoring: Datadog 
·         Quality Management: Code Reviews, PRs, CodeClimate 
·         Project Management: Jira
